When it comes to insurance, the term "floaters" is not the most recognized or used term for coverage.  However, Floaters can be very one of the most important coverage's that you can add to your Homeowners policy. Floaters are used to cover easily movable items such as jewelry, fine arts, firearms, musical instruments, cameras, cell phones, and more. The history of floaters goes back to the origin of insurance, Marine policies, where property being shipped across the ocean was insured or underwritten by various "names" willing to accept the risk of a specified voyage for a premium paid in advance of the voyage. Ship, Boat, Pirate Ship, Sea, Rough Sea If the vessel arrived safely, the premium was kept the the names and placed into a reserve fund designed to cover any future losses.  The evolution of insurance continued when Inland Marine policies were developed as a natural extension of Marine policies.  Inland Marine is the term used to described property on vessels but instead of ocean exposure, the inland marine policies covered property being moved on inland waterways such as rivers and lakes.  Eventually, underwriters began to offer coverage for most easily movable property under the Insurance Floater concept. What does it mean to you?  Since your Homeowners policy primarily insures property at the location specified on your policy - the structure or dwelling, your personal property, detached structures, fences - it is necessary to add coverage when you commonly remove items from your location.  One of the most common floaters for Homeowners is the jewelry schedule.  Since jewelry is mostly on the person and not the premises, the floater specifies the item(s) to be covered, and the coverage extends beyond the residence (location on the policy).  Should a scheduled item get lost, damaged, stolen or just plain disappears, the insurance company will pay to replace that scheduled item up to the amount listed on the policy.
